
"Advanced caching with Valkey can significantly enhance web app performance by ensuring that backend data is delivered quickly and consistently, thus improving user experience."
"Valkey was developed as a fully open-source fork of Redis to address concerns over a more restrictive licensing model, ensuring that developers can maintain trust and continuity."
"The tutorial provides insights into layered caching, cache invalidation, and key namespacing, making it a comprehensive guide for setting up an advanced caching layer in Node.js applications."
"Real-world applications of this caching method include ecommerce platforms and content delivery networks where varying data types and freshness requirements necessitate efficient caching strategies."
The article introduces a tutorial on implementing an advanced caching layer using Valkey, a highly efficient, Redis-compatible datastore. It emphasizes the importance of caching in enhancing backend data delivery for web applications, especially those handling dynamic and frequently requested data. With real-time use cases, such as ecommerce and content platforms, the tutorial outlines how to leverage Valkey's features like layered caching, cache invalidation, and key namespacing within a modular Express architecture, aiming to provide flexibility and precision in data handling. Valkey's emergence as an open-source alternative to Redis is also highlighted, in light of recent licensing changes by Redis Labs.
